python中用numpy的array操作问题
a=array([[1,2,3,4],[7,8,9,10],[5,6,7,10]]),b=array([4,5,6]),想把b放到a的后边一起组成c=array([[1,...
a = array([[1,2,3,4],[7,8,9,10],[5,6,7,10]]), b = array([4,5,6]),想把b放到a的后边一起组成c = array([[1,2,3,4],[7,8,9,10],[5,6,7,10], [4,5,6])]),可以用numpy的哪个函数
展开
2个回答
展开全部
我不会matlab,没看懂,不过python本来的列表操作已经够强大了。希望能详细补充一下。
就直接说要用python干什么,然后我给你写。
假如没有理解错,应该是这样:
a = []
b = [1,2,3]
c = [4,5,6]
A: a = [b,c] 得 a = [[1,2,3],[4,5,6]]
B: a.append(b) 得 a = [[1,2,3]],再a.append(c) 得a=[[1,2,3],[4,5,6]]
C: a = b+c 得 a = [1,2,3,4,5,6]
明了否?
就直接说要用python干什么,然后我给你写。
假如没有理解错,应该是这样:
a = []
b = [1,2,3]
c = [4,5,6]
A: a = [b,c] 得 a = [[1,2,3],[4,5,6]]
B: a.append(b) 得 a = [[1,2,3]],再a.append(c) 得a=[[1,2,3],[4,5,6]]
C: a = b+c 得 a = [1,2,3,4,5,6]
明了否?
追问
和matlab没有关系,我用的是numpy library,如果你要是不了解numpy那就算了。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询